Woman Wants To Cleanse Colons In Her Home

And she's fighting city council to do so.

LOGAN, Utah -- A woman is fighting the City Council in Providence to issue her a permit to run a colon-cleansing service out of her home.

Colon hydrotherapy (...) focuses on removing waste from the large intestine by injecting water into the colon, where it loosens and softens waste. The water is injected through the rectum.

And the key quote:
Yates said commissioners are wary because they're not familiar with the procedure, though she provided them with detailed videos and literature.
I can imagine the city council loved sitting through videos of people with tubes running up their butt. Or was she trying to say that the council members needed to get an cleansing themselves?
